Welcome to Bacon Bitch

Bacon Bitch, located in Miami Beach, offers a unique dining experience with a diverse menu that caters to both brunch and lunch enthusiasts. The atmosphere is lively and hipster-friendly, making it a great spot for celebrations. The service is attentive, despite potential wait times. The griddle sliders and million dollar bacon skillet are popular choices, with a mix of sweet and savory flavors. The playful use of the word bitch adds to the fun vibe of the restaurant. Overall, Bacon Bitch is a must-visit for those looking for a memorable dining experience in Miami Beach.

The perfect place to kick off celebrations for your birthday, Bach, or any fun time. But don't come here if you're not cool with being called b*tch. My group of 10 came here for a bachelorette brunch on a Friday morning. We did make a reservation online ahead of time but we underestimated Miami traffic and half of our party was super late. Thankfully, they were kind enough to still get us a table. They even gave us a free shot while we waited for the rest of our crew. The space itself is pretty much all outside, mostly on a covered patio. It was a warm Miami late morning so it was perfect to be outside in a shaded area. They have lots of options on the menu and there was something for all of us whether we were wanting something healthier like the veggie breakfast bowl or something more decadent like the boujee pancakes. I ordered the fried chicken & waffles ($22) which also came with bacon, eggs, and hot honey. The waffle was soft and sweet and the chicken was good. It's not as crispy as other places I've tried and it's a fillet vs getting a drumstick/thigh. The bacon was as expected and the hot honey wasn't too hot/spicy. I also got the emotion frozen slushy ($15) which had rum, mango, strawberry, and lime. Delicious! And I was able to take it to-go since we ordered it at the very end of the meal. We ended up going walking to the beach after brunch and this was the perfect thing to sip on while relaxing under the sun. My group also took advantage of the check in offer for free cafe con leches! Let them know if you're celebrating something and enjoy the "surprise" spotlight + shots ;) Parking is pretty much street parking so carve out a bit of time to drive around to find a spot. Like I mentioned above, it's walking distance from the beach so you can plan to spend a few hours in the area!

Welcome to Bacon Bitch, a trendy and casual cocktail bar located in Miami Beach, FL. This vibrant spot offers a unique dining experience with a wide range of menu options for breakfast, brunch, and lunch.

At Bacon Bitch, you can enjoy delicious dishes like griddle sliders, million dollar bacon skillet, maple griddle sliders, and fried chicken & waffles. The menu is extensive, catering to both meat lovers and vegetarians with vegan options available as well.

Customers rave about the fun and lively atmosphere at Bacon Bitch, where the staff affectionately calls everyone bitch as part of the dining experience. The service is attentive and quick, ensuring a memorable meal for all guests.

In addition to the fantastic food, Bacon Bitch offers a range of amenities including outdoor seating, free Wi-Fi, full bar, and happy hour specials. The gender-neutral restrooms, dog-friendly policy, and diverse payment options make this restaurant inclusive and welcoming to all.
